**System Information**
Operating system: Windows-10
Graphics card: GeForce GTX 960M
**Blender Version**
Broken: version: 2.93.0 Alpha, branch: master, commit date: 2021-04-10 16:36, hash: `rBed5507de8a25`
Worked: (newest version of Blender that worked as expected)
**Short description of error**
With Metallic objects, New Screenspace reflections and AO implementation (or another cause or bug is maybe the reason) creates over-darkening and unexpected results (when there is a metallic object) that can also be seen on Specular Light Pass from viewport passes as well as just by looking at a metallic object in combined pass
**Exact steps for others to reproduce the error**
Create a plane without adding or changing its material and scale by 5 and move -1 (down)
Edit the material of default cube and make metallic value 1 to make it metal
Change viewport shading settings to not use scene world and use forest HDRI and maximize world opacity and remove blur
Then in viewport go to specular light pass on camera view for example
then first activate ambient occlusion and it will make it everything over-dark (observe)
then second activate screenspace reflections and it will make everything dark on specular light pass
Also Go to combined pass of viewport- the metal cube will have strange dark shadows and darker reflections due when u use AO+SSR
!! Compare this with 2.92.0 and there specular light pass is working properly and metal cube doesnt have strange over-dark look etc. when AO and SSR is active